Grahanandan Singh
Indian field hockey player From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
Grahanandan Singh (18 February 1926 in Lyallpur, British India – 7 December 2014 in New Delhi, India) was an Indian field hockey player who won two gold medals, at the 1948 and 1952 Summer Olympics. There is a documentary film on the team.[1]
